1. The Cocktail Pool

The Cocktail Pool

Imagine sipping a cool drink while lounging in your very own cocktail pool. These petite pools are perfect for smaller spaces, offering just enough room for a refreshing dip.

Their compact size means they heat up quickly, so you can enjoy a warm soak even in the cooler months.

Many cocktail pools come equipped with jets, turning your tiny oasis into a spa-like retreat. Add a couple of floating chairs, and you’ve got the ultimate relaxation spot.

Plus, the smaller footprint means less maintenance, giving you more time to enjoy and less time to clean.

2. Plunge Pool

Plunge Pool

Plunge pools are the perfect fit for those who want a quick splash without the commitment of a full-sized pool. These little beauties are deep enough for a refreshing plunge and small enough to fit into the tiniest of backyards.

With their stylish designs, they add a touch of elegance to any outdoor space. You can even incorporate a waterfall for that extra wow factor.

Plunge pools also conserve water, making them an eco-friendly choice. Just dive in and cool down, without the hassle of a large pool.

3. Spool (Spa+Pool)

Spool (Spa+Pool)

Meet the spool, the delightful offspring of a spa and a pool. Ideal for small yards, a spool offers the best of both worlds—relaxing jets and enough room for a refreshing dip.

These adorable hybrids are perfect for entertaining guests or unwinding solo.

A spool’s compact design means you can get creative with landscaping, adding plants or lighting to enhance your backyard paradise.

The adjustable water temperature allows for year-round enjoyment. So whether it’s a chilly winter evening or a scorching summer day, your spool’s got you covered.

4. Lap Pool

Lap Pool

For fitness fanatics, a lap pool in a small yard is a dream come true. These narrow pools allow you to swim laps without needing a full-sized pool. Perfect for exercise enthusiasts who want to maintain their routine within their limited space.

Lap pools are also great for families, offering a safe and controlled environment for kids to learn swimming basics.

With sleek designs and efficient use of space, they transform your backyard into a personal fitness center. So grab your goggles and start making waves!

5. Infinity Edge Pool

Infinity Edge Pool

Infinity edge pools bring a touch of luxury to even the smallest of yards. These stunning pools create an illusion of endless water, perfect for a breathtaking view in a compact space.

While they may seem extravagant, infinity edge pools are surprisingly adaptable to small yards. With smart design choices, they become the crown jewel of any backyard.

A small waterfall effect enhances the illusion, providing soothing sounds and visuals. It’s the perfect way to elevate your backyard experience to new heights.
